The Role of Sample Development in Bag Manufacturing
Before any backpack reaches mass production, it begins with one crucial step — sample development. This stage determines not only how your product will look and feel, but also how efficiently it can be produced at scale.
Understanding the role of sample development helps brands shorten timelines, improve quality, and prevent costly rework later in production.
1. The Three Types of Samples
Most professional factories follow a structured sample development process:
Mock-up / Rough Sample – Used to test general size, structure, and concept. Often made from substitute materials.
Pre-production / Sales Sample – Made with actual materials to check overall appearance, sewing accuracy, and construction.
Final Production Sample (Golden Sample) – The approved standard used to guide mass production and QC checks.
Each stage builds upon the previous one. Rushing through or skipping steps may save time temporarily but often results in inconsistent production quality.
2. Why Sampling Takes Time
Many brands underestimate how long sampling takes. Each sample involves multiple internal steps — pattern making, cutting, sewing, fitting, and adjustments. Depending on design complexity and material availability, one sample may require 7–20 working days.
High-end backpacks with multiple layers, molded components, or waterproof materials require extra precision and testing. Factories must balance efficiency with accuracy to ensure the sample reflects final production quality.
3. Communication During Sampling
Sampling is the best time to test communication with your factory. If your supplier provides detailed updates, notes potential risks, and offers improvement suggestions, it’s a strong indicator of long-term reliability.
During revisions, always document what has changed from one version to another — whether it’s material thickness, zipper direction, or logo placement. These records become critical references during production.
4. Cost and Ownership of Samples
Factories often charge a sample fee, which covers labor and materials. Professional suppliers will refund or deduct this fee once the bulk order is confirmed.
Be mindful of intellectual property ownership — unless stated otherwise, the design remains the brand’s property, while the physical sample belongs to the factory. Always clarify this early to protect your design rights.
5. The Link Between Sampling and Production Efficiency
A well-developed sample acts as the foundation for production. Once approved, pattern masters digitize the final patterns, and the production team builds jigs, cutting templates, and standard operating procedures.
If the sample is flawed or unclear, those mistakes will multiply across hundreds or thousands of units. Precision during sample approval saves significant time and cost later.
6. When to Freeze the Sample
Once both sides confirm all details — materials, workmanship, and specifications — the sample should be frozen. This means no further changes unless absolutely necessary. Late modifications, even minor ones, can disrupt material procurement and scheduling.
Professional factories maintain a dedicated archive of approved samples for traceability and consistency across reorders.
